Thermal Transfer Printing: Superior Customization for Safety Gear

Thermal transfer printing, alternatively referred to as heat transfer vinyl (HTV), is the most prevalent method for customising safety apparel. In this process, a digital design is meticulously delineated from a coloured vinyl sheet and subsequently applied to fabric through the utilisation of heat and pressure. The outcome of this process is a graphic that is both crisp and durable, and which adheres securely to the garment. The utilisation of thermal transfer in this context is predicated on its ability to reproduce designs with multiple colours, gradients, or fine details with exceptional fidelity. Furthermore, it is capable of accommodating both small-scale productions and individual orders without the necessity for additional setup, a feature that is not always available in screen printing.

The advantages of HTV for safety vests are significant. Initially, the colour vibrancy of HTV inks must be considered. These inks are pre-pigmented, resulting in bright, sharp logos and text. Secondly, the durability of properly applied vinyl is superior to that of some alternative print methods, with the ability to withstand stretching and abrasion. Furthermore, HTV designs are characterised by their complete flexibility and softness to the touch, a quality that is paramount for ensuring comfort when the garment is worn in conjunction with a vest. Following the application of heat to the vinyl, the material has been integrated into the fabric, thus creating a waterproof barrier over the print.

It is imperative to exercise caution when undertaking custom workwear projects, as these pieces are often intended for prolonged use and thus necessitate a meticulous approach to maintenance. It is imperative to always wash HTV-printed garments inside-out in cold water. It is recommended that a mild detergent be used on a gentle cycle. Indeed, the consensus among experts in the field is that the most effective method of minimising stress on the design is by means of manual washing. This straightforward care regime has been developed to ensure the preservation of both the neon fabric and the printed logo. It is imperative to note that this procedure is to be repeated after each instance of use in order to maximise the longevity of the product.

When employed in the context of custom safety vests and reflective shirts, thermal transfer printing ensures a polished aesthetic. The company's nomenclature and safety instructions are rendered in a legible manner on the anterior or posterior aspect of the garment. HTV has the capacity to print multicolored corporate logos, with full-color images exhibiting smooth edges. Reflective HTV options are also available, comprising vinyl with an integrated reflective surface that enables the logo itself to reflect light in low-light conditions.

From a manufacturing standpoint, thermal transfer has proven to be an efficient method. The garments are printed "on demand" subsequent to artwork approval. This reduced lead time renders it well-suited for both bulk orders and for meeting last-minute requirements. The process of omitting screens and plates facilitates the expeditious execution of minor reorders or corrections. In essence, thermal transfer printing ensures that custom safety equipment, such as vests or shirts, is delivered with visually appealing graphics that are engineered to withstand prolonged use.
